Was Boba Fett evil?

Basically, Fett was born to be bad: He was raised as the clone of a ruthless bounty hunter, orphaned at an early age, and forced to fend for himself or die trying. He lived outside the law for most of his existence, and wasn't above siding with the dark side to get ahead.

Is Boba Fett a villain or anti-hero?

Boba was never presented as an evil figure in the same vein as Emperor Palpatine or Darth Vader, but as an anti-hero willing to work for whoever would pay him. That made him a compelling character, one who existed in a morally gray space that most other Star Wars characters don't.

Why is Boba Fett disfigured?

Boba Fett ended up inside Sarlacc's stomach [1]. While being digested alive and close to being breathless, Boba Fett was exposed to the digestive enzymes of the giant intergalactic monster. Due to this, Boba Fett's skin was burned and ended up scarred.

Who is Boba Fett in love with?

At some point in her youth, Sintas would take up the profession of bounty hunting. It was during her career as a bounty hunter that Sintas would meet fellow bounty hunter, Boba Fett. The two fell in love and were married in 16 BBY, when Sintas was eighteen and Fett sixteen years old.

Why is Din Djarin so shiny?

In contrast, Din Djarin's armor was made from pure beskar, earned through the bounty on Grogu. This made Djarin's armor rare and even more durable than normal Mandalorian armor, allowing it to stay shiny and undamaged even when he walked into a barrage of blaster fire.
